Understanding Google Ads

Google Ads, formerly known as Google AdWords, is a powerful online advertising platform that allows businesses to display ads on Google’s search engine results pages.

This means that when potential customers search for products or services related to your business, your ad has the opportunity to appear, increasing your visibility.

Setting your budget right

One of the appealing aspects of Google Ads for small businesses is the ability to set a daily budget. 

This pay-per-click (PPC) model ensures that you only pay when someone clicks on your ad. 

This level of control over spending makes it accessible for businesses with varying budgets, and gives you flexibility to test and learn fast.

The key to success though lies in your keyword selection, your audience targeting and the ongoing management of the campaign. If you any part of that strategy is not top notch, you run the risk of not getting the return you want from the campaign. 

Additionally, the landing page you are driving prospects to, along with your website more generally, have to also capaitlise on the interest and traffic driven from your Google Ads. There is little point in having a great click through rate on the ads, and then a low engagement rate or point of conversion on your website. The two must work together. This is why a more holistic PPC plan is needed than simply turning on Google Ads.

5. Skepticism regarding click fraud

Concern: Businesses may express concerns about competitors or malicious entities clicking on their ads, leading to unnecessary costs.

Debunked: Google Ads employs advanced algorithms and technologies to detect and filter out invalid clicks, including those resulting from click fraud. This ensures that your budget is used efficiently and that you only pay for genuine clicks from potential customers.

6. Misconceptions about instant results

Concern: Some businesses expect immediate results and are concerned if they don’t see a drastic change shortly after starting a Google Ads campaign.

Debunked: While Google Ads can yield quick results, the timeline for success varies based on factors such as industry, competition, and your bid / targeting settings. It’s essential to view Google Ads as a long-term strategy, allowing time for optimisation and gradual growth.
